Content Editor Job Description Duties at We Level Up NJ

The work of a content editor in a healthcare setting is unique. It requires a mix of writing skills, medical knowledge, and deep empathy. Here are the primary duties that define the role at our center.

Ensuring Medical Accuracy

One of the main tasks is checking facts in the content about treatment and addiction. Our content editor reviews each piece carefully. They make sure the information follows current, evidence-based standards.

In healthcare, wrong information can lead to poor decisions. Because of this, every claim is reviewed and verified. All content must be supported by trusted sources and clinical guidance.

Maintaining Compassionate and Stigma-Free Language

Language can affect how people feel and respond. We write for patients, families, and professionals who may be going through difficult situations.

Our content editor reviews all content to remove harmful or triggering language. We use person-first language that respects each individual. This helps readers feel supported, not judged.

The goal is to create a safe and respectful space where people can learn and seek help.

SEO and Content Optimization

For our resources to help people, they must be easy to find online. Our content editor structures each page for readability and search intent. Keywords are added naturally, so articles appear when someone searches for help. At the same time, we never let search engine optimization reduce clarity. The goal is to make information both easy to find and easy to understand.

Compliance and Ethical Standards

Following healthcare content guidelines is required. Our content editor stays updated on current regulations. This helps prevent misinformation. We focus on clear and accurate health information at all times.

Website Content Editor Tasks in a Treatment Center

Our content editor reviews blogs, landing pages, and treatment resources every day. Medical information can change over time. Because of this, older content needs regular updates. These updates help keep our website accurate and useful for readers.

The content editor also works closely with clinicians, therapists, and the marketing team. This teamwork helps keep our message clear and consistent. Whether someone reads a blog or speaks with our team, the tone remains the same.

The editor also improves readability and user experience. This makes it easier for people to find important information. For someone in crisis, it can help them quickly locate the “Contact Us” page or learn about treatment options.
